Harnessing Data to Build Smarter Cities

The world’s population is rapidly urbanizing, as larger numbers of people are moving to cities in search of employment opportunities, improved living standards, and access to essential services. As a result, the challenges of building smarter cities are becoming ever more critical. One of the critical success factors in building smarter cities is harnessing data from various sources and using it to gain insights that can drive policy and operational decisions. In this article, we will discuss how data can be leveraged to build smarter cities that meet the needs of residents, promote sustainability, and boost economic growth.

Why We Need Smarter Cities

A smarter city is one that leverages advanced technologies and data to make better-informed decisions. The benefits of building smarter cities are numerous, including:

  • Improved Service Delivery
  • Smarter cities can provide better services to residents, such as transportation, healthcare, public safety, and education. These services can be customized to meet the unique needs and preferences of residents, providing a more seamless and efficient experience.

  • Increased Sustainability
  • Smarter cities can be designed to be more sustainable by leveraging data to inform decisions about energy and resource usage. This can reduce greenhouse gas emissions, minimize waste, and lower energy costs.

  • Enhanced Economic Growth
  • Smarter cities can help to boost economic growth by leveraging data and technology to facilitate innovation, increase the efficiency of operations, and attract investment.

Leveraging Data to Build Smarter Cities

Data is the fuel that powers smarter cities, and the following are some ways that data can be harnessed to improve city planning and operations:

  1. Collecting and Analyzing Data
  2. To build smarter cities, it is essential to collect and analyze data from various sources, such as IoT devices, social media, and sensor data. This data can be used to gain insights into how people move through the city, what services they use, and how they interact with the built environment. Advanced analytics techniques, such as predictive modeling and machine learning, can be used to extract valuable insights from this data.

  3. Using Data to Enhance Transportation Systems
  4. Transportation is a critical component of any city, and data can be leveraged to optimize transportation systems. For instance, real-time traffic data can be used to reroute traffic to avoid congestion, while data from public transportation systems can be used to improve schedules and routes. Data can also be used to develop mobility solutions that prioritize pedestrians, cyclists, and public transportation.

  5. Leveraging Data for Safety and Security
  6. Data can be used to enhance public safety and security by enabling automated monitoring of public areas and quick response to emergencies. For instance, video analytics can be used to detect suspicious behavior and alert law enforcement in real-time.

  7. Improving Energy Efficiency
  8. Data can be used to improve energy efficiency, promote sustainability, and reduce greenhouse gas emissions. For instance, smart grid technology can be leveraged to manage energy usage in real-time, while data can be used to optimize building energy usage and reduce energy costs.

  9. Providing Personalized Services
  10. Data can be used to provide personalized services to residents, such as tailored healthcare services, personalized recommendations of local events and businesses, and customized transportation routes. This can lead to higher satisfaction levels and greater utilization of city services.

  11. Enhancing City Planning
  12. Data can be used to guide strategic city planning decisions, such as where to locate new businesses and services, how to allocate resources, and how to optimize infrastructure investments. By leveraging data, city planners can make better-informed decisions that address the needs and preferences of residents.

Case Studies of Smarter Cities

Numerous cities around the world have started to leverage data and technology to build smarter cities that meet the needs of residents and promote sustainability. The following are some examples of cities that have effectively harnessed data to build smarter cities:

  • Singapore
  • Singapore is one of the leading examples of a smart city, where data is leveraged to improve almost every aspect of life in the city-state. The government has invested heavily in IoT sensors, which are used to collect data on everything from traffic flow to waste management. This data is then used to inform decision-making, such as optimizing traffic flow and managing waste more efficiently. Singapore has also leveraged data to develop personalized healthcare services, such as virtual consultations and remote monitoring of chronic conditions.

  • Dubai
  • Dubai has been investing in smart city technology since 2013, with a focus on using data to improve transportation and energy efficiency. The city is leveraging IoT sensors and big data analytics to optimize traffic flow and reduce congestion, while also promoting sustainable transportation options, such as electric vehicles. Dubai is also using data to improve energy efficiency, with initiatives like smart lighting systems that use sensors to adjust lighting levels depending on occupancy.

  • Barcelona
  • Barcelona has been an early adopter of smart city technology, with a focus on using data to improve public transportation and enhance quality of life for residents. The city has implemented a smart bus network that optimizes routes based on real-time traffic data, while also increasing the frequency of bus services during peak hours. Barcelona has also used data to develop a smart lighting system that adjusts lighting levels based on occupancy and is expected to reduce energy consumption by up to 30%.
